Causes of App Incompatibility

The reasons why an app may not work for a particular device are varied. Here are some of the most common causes:

1. Operating System Differences

Mobile operating systems (OS), such as Android, iOS, and Windows, have distinct architectures and specifications. Apps are designed and developed to work within specific OS ecosystems, and they may not function correctly on other platforms due to fundamental differences in hardware and software components.

2. Hardware Limitations

The hardware capabilities of a device play a crucial role in app compatibility. Factors such as processor speed, RAM size, and screen resolution can determine whether an app can be installed and run on a particular device. Apps that require significant resources may not perform optimally or may not run at all on devices with limited hardware specifications.

3. Device Age and Compatibility Updates

Older devices may not support newer app versions due to hardware limitations or outdated software. App developers regularly release updates that introduce new features, fix bugs, and improve performance. However, these updates may require newer hardware or software versions that are not available on older devices.

4. Regional Restrictions

Some apps may be restricted to certain geographical regions due to licensing agreements or regulatory requirements. This means that users in certain countries or areas may not be able to access or use specific applications.

How to Check App Compatibility

Before downloading an app, it’s crucial to check its compatibility with your device. Here are some steps to follow:

1. Read App Descriptions

App descriptions on app marketplaces typically include information about compatibility requirements. Look for mentions of supported operating systems, device models, and minimum hardware specifications.

2. Visit Developer Websites

Some developers provide detailed compatibility information on their websites. Visit the developer’s website to check if your device is supported before downloading the app.

3. Read User Reviews

User reviews can provide valuable insights into app compatibility. Check if other users have reported issues with the app on your specific device model.

4. Contact Customer Support

If you’re unsure about app compatibility, you can contact the app developer’s customer support team. They can provide up-to-date information about device support and resolve any compatibility issues.
